·设为首页收藏本站📧邮箱修改🎁免费下载专区📒收藏夹👽聊天室📱AI智能体
返回列表 发布新帖

请问一下这样的左边信息栏怎么实现的

104 2
发表于 2025-2-14 22:06:42 | 查看全部 阅读模式

马上注册,免费下载更多dz插件网资源。

您需要 登录 才可以下载或查看,没有账号?立即注册

×
请问一下这样的左边信息栏怎么实现的 信息栏边框,信息栏图标 第一个是天天签到插件,但是后面两个怎么做出来的
我知道答案 回答被采纳将会获得1 贡献 已有0人回答
我要说一句 收起回复

评论2

JINQIKELv.2 发表于 2025-2-14 23:11:57 | 查看全部 | Google Chrome | Windows 10
请问一下这样的左边信息栏怎么实现的 信息栏边框,信息栏图标

修改帖内用户信息
我要说一句 收起回复
Discuz智能体Lv.8 发表于 2025-3-18 06:15:55 | 查看全部
要实现类似左边信息栏的效果,你可以通过以下几种方式来实现:

### 1. **天天签到插件**
   天天签到插件通常是通过安装一个现成的插件来实现的。你可以在DZ插件网(https://www.dz-x.net/)上找到类似的签到插件,安装后按照插件的说明进行配置即可。

### 2. **自定义信息栏**
   如果你想要实现类似天天签到插件后面的两个信息栏,可以通过以下几种方式来实现:

   #### 方法一:使用模板修改
   1. **找到模板文件**:通常这些信息栏是通过修改模板文件来实现的。你可以找到 `template/default/forum/discuz.htm` 或者 `template/default/forum/viewthread.htm` 文件,具体取决于你想要在哪个页面显示这些信息栏。
   
   2. **添加HTML代码**:在模板文件中找到合适的位置,添加你想要的HTML代码。例如:
     
  1. <div class="left-info">
  2.           <h3>信息栏1</h3>
  3.           <p>这里是信息栏1的内容。</p>
  4.       </div>
  5.       <div class="left-info">
  6.           <h3>信息栏2</h3>
  7.           <p>这里是信息栏2的内容。</p>
  8.       </div>
复制代码

   
   3. **添加CSS样式**:为了让信息栏看起来更美观,你可以在 `template/default/common/common.css` 文件中添加一些CSS样式:
     
  1. .left-info {
  2.           margin-bottom: 10px;
  3.           padding: 10px;
  4.           background-color: #f9f9f9;
  5.           border: 1px solid #ddd;
  6.           border-radius: 5px;
  7.       }
  8.       .left-info h3 {
  9.           margin-top: 0;
  10.       }
复制代码


   #### 方法二:使用插件扩展
   如果你不想手动修改模板文件,可以通过开发一个自定义插件来实现。你可以参考Discuz的开发手册(https://addon.dismall.com/library/)来学习如何开发插件。

   1. **创建插件**:在 `source/plugin/` 目录下创建一个新的插件目录,例如 `my_left_info`。
   
   2. **编写插件代码**:在插件目录下创建 `my_left_info.class.php` 文件,编写插件的逻辑代码。例如:
     
  1. <?php
  2.       if (!defined('IN_DISCUZ')) {
  3.           exit('Access Denied');
  4.       }
  5.       
  6.       class plugin_my_left_info {
  7.           function global_left_info() {
  8.               return '<div class="left-info">
  9.                   <h3>信息栏1</h3>
  10.                   <p>这里是信息栏1的内容。</p>
  11.               </div>
  12.               <div class="left-info">
  13.                   <h3>信息栏2</h3>
  14.                   <p>这里是信息栏2的内容。</p>
  15.               </div>';
  16.           }
  17.       }
  18.       ?>
复制代码

   
   3. **挂载插件**:在 `source/plugin/my_left_info/` 目录下创建 `discuz_plugin_my_left_info.xml` 文件,定义插件的挂载点:
     
  1. <?xml version="1.0" encoding="UTF-8"?>
  2.       <root>
  3.           <plugin name="my_left_info" version="1.0" discuzVersion="X3.4">
  4.               <hook name="global_left_info" script="my_left_info.class.php" />
  5.           </plugin>
  6.       </root>
复制代码

   
   4. **安装插件**:在后台插件管理中安装并启用这个插件。

### 3. **使用模块管理**
   如果你不想修改代码,也可以通过Discuz的模块管理功能来实现。在后台的“门户”或“论坛”模块管理中,你可以添加自定义的HTML模块,然后将这些模块放置在页面的左侧栏中。

### 总结
- **天天签到插件**:直接安装现成的插件。
- **自定义信息栏**:可以通过修改模板文件、开发自定义插件或使用模块管理来实现。

希望这些方法能帮助你实现你想要的效果!如果有更多问题,欢迎继续提问。
-- 本回答由 人工智能 AI智能体 生成,内容仅供参考,请仔细甄别。
我要说一句 收起回复

回复

 懒得打字嘛,点击右侧快捷回复【查看最新发布】   【应用商城享更多资源】
您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

关闭

站长推荐上一条 /1 下一条

AI智能体
投诉/建议联系

discuzaddons@vip.qq.com

未经授权禁止转载,复制和建立镜像,
如有违反,按照公告处理!!!
  • 联系QQ客服
  • 添加微信客服

联系DZ插件网微信客服|最近更新|Archiver|手机版|小黑屋|DZ插件网! ( 鄂ICP备20010621号-1 )|网站地图 知道创宇云防御

您的IP:3.135.223.70,GMT+8, 2025-5-16 00:07 , Processed in 1.338686 second(s), 78 queries , Gzip On, Redis On.

Powered by Discuz! X5.0 Licensed

© 2001-2025 Discuz! Team.

关灯 在本版发帖
扫一扫添加微信客服
QQ客服返回顶部
快速回复 返回顶部 返回列表